Xiaohong Quan

Partner at TSVC

Xiaohong (Iris) Quan is a Partner at TSVC since May 2017 and has served as a Professor of Entrepreneurship at San Jose State University's Lucas College and Graduate School of Business since August 2007. Previously, Quan was an IEEE TEMS Board Member from January 2017 to December 2019 and a visiting research fellow at the National University of Singapore from October 2006 to August 2007. Additional experience includes a research fellowship at Stanford University from September 2005 to October 2006 and an internship at NTT DoCoMo in 2003. Educational qualifications include a PhD in Regional Economic Development from the University of California, Berkeley, a research fellowship in Entrepreneurship/Entrepreneurial Studies from Stanford University, and a B.S. and M.E. in Urban Planning and Regional Economics from Peking University.

TSVC

TSVC is a venture capital firm that focuses on early-stage deep technology startups. TSVC invests in forward-thinking ideas and cutting-edge deep technologies as well as partnering with founders in Silicon Valley’s entrepreneurial community.TSVC delivers outstanding returns to investors by funding over 160 startups in deep tech-focused areas likeSaaS, AI chips, Fintech, Biotech, Blockchain, and Semiconductors. Their mission is to support entrepreneurs with unique insights and solid technical expertise and to bring them distinctive values along with crucial funding to make their ideas into reality. TSVC's investment philosophy centers on the belief that today’s visionaries will make tomorrow’s reality.TSVC was founded in 2010 and is based in Los Altos, California.
